I want to use parallel computing on matlab, i have i7-960 http://ark.intel.com/fr/products/37151/Intel-Core-i7-960-Processor-8M-Cache-3_20-GHz-4_80-GTs-Intel-QPI CPU with 4 cores and 8 threads, when i run feature('numCores') command in matlab, i obtain this
feature('numCores')
MATLAB detected: 3 physical cores.
MATLAB detected: 6 logical cores.
MATLAB was assigned: 6 logical cores by the OS.
MATLAB is using: 3 logical cores.
MATLAB is not using all logical cores because hyper-threading is enabled.
ans =
3
why matlab detect just juste 3 physical cores ! and how can i use all logical and physical cores for parallel computing. thanks.

To use all logical processes (number of threads) you need to change the NumWorkers in the matlab setting. in matlab 2018 menu follow this: Preferences >> Parallel Computing Toolbox>> Cluster Profile Manager >> click "Edit" on the bottom right >> Set "NumWorkers" to the number of logical process, 8 in your case. >> Done >> close and apply
